English: View of the sonar dome of the AN/SQS-26 sonar of the U.S. Navy guided missile cruiser USS William H. Standley (CG-32) in a dry dock at the Puget Sound Naval Shipyard, Washington (USA), in 1984. During high-speed trials, the sonar dome haddeveloped a split.
